Psychopathic Cyber Freak by Brian Rhodes

Grade Level - 4

 

 

"The Psychopathis Cyber Freak" has been described as "What Is Hip" meets "Purple Haze." There is a definite Don Ellis influence in this tune as well. This slow rock tune is pretty weird, but effective. The overall sound is somewhat kooky with loads of 16th note rock rhythms and out harmonies. The solos are for guitar (w / distortion) and alto sax. This tune might be the off beat selection to add variety to any jazz concert.

Instrumentation: 5,4,4,4
Range: (C1=Middle C)  
Trpt. D3, Tbn. Ab1

Piano: RH - Voicings, LH - Chord Chart
Bass: Written out with chord changes provided.
Style: Slow Psycho Rock
